Senior EA & Office Manager — London

Global Asset Management | Full-time

Help build our new London office from the ground up. We’re a leading global asset manager seeking a senior-level Executive Assistant & Office Manager to support the MD and run day-to-day operations as part of an exciting office launch.

What you’ll do

  • Provide full PA support to the MD: complex diary management and international travel
  • Prepare high-quality PowerPoint presentations and board materials
  • Plan and deliver global events and senior meetings
  • Lead office operations: vendor management, budgets, policies, and H&S
  • Project manage the London office set-up and move-in

What you’ll bring

  • 5+ years’ EA/Office Manager experience in financial services
  • Proven success managing an office move or new office set-up
  • Advanced MS Office (especially PowerPoint); superb organisation and discretion
  • Comfortable in a small, fast-growing team; strong stakeholder skills

Why join us

  • Collaborative, supportive, and progressive culture
  • Exposure to senior leadership and long-term stability
  • Competitive package and genuine growth opportunities

How to prepare for a job interview at Orla Rose Associates

✨Know Your Role Inside Out

Before the interview, make sure you thoroughly understand the responsibilities of a Personal Assistant in a financial services environment. Familiarise yourself with complex diary management, international travel arrangements, and the specifics of office operations. This will help you demonstrate your expertise and show that you're the right fit for the role.

✨Showcase Your Presentation Skills

Since preparing high-quality PowerPoint presentations is a key part of the job, be ready to discuss your experience with this. Bring examples of past presentations or even create a mock-up to showcase your skills. This will not only impress them but also give you a chance to highlight your attention to detail and creativity.

✨Demonstrate Your Project Management Experience

The role involves project managing the London office set-up, so be prepared to talk about your previous experiences in managing office moves or new setups. Share specific examples of challenges you faced and how you overcame them, as this will illustrate your problem-solving abilities and organisational skills.

✨Engage with Their Culture

Research the company’s culture and values before the interview. Be ready to discuss how your personal work style aligns with their collaborative and supportive environment. Showing that you’re not just looking for a job, but a place where you can grow and contribute positively, will resonate well with the interviewers.
